Pendas : Jurnah Ilmiah Pendidikan Dasar is a journal published twice a year, namely in June and December that aims to be a forum for scientific publications to pour ideas and studies complemented with the results of research related to primary school education. To achieve this, basic education journals will selectively disseminate ideas and studies complemented by quality research results related to basic education, develop an education center to the elementary-school that can produce innovative, creative and original work and tested in the field of education and learning elementary School to be disseminated and implemented for improving the quality of primary-to-national education at the national, regional and international levels.

Abstract

This study examines the implementation of Human Resource Management (HRM) and its impact on learning effectiveness at SDN 1 Metro Selatan. Using a qualitative approach with an intrinsic case study, this study aims to describe the implementation of HRM, analyze the level of learning effectiveness, and identify the influence of HRM on improving learning effectiveness. Data were collected through in-depth interviews, observations, and documentation studies with the principal, teachers, and administrative staff. The results indicate that the implementation of HRM at SDN 1 Metro Selatan is running well, focusing on continuous teacher competency development, nurturing supervision, and transformational leadership that creates a collaborative work climate. Learning effectiveness is high, characterized by good student learning outcomes, active student activities, and teachers' ability to manage innovative learning. It was found that the implementation of HRM, particularly in the development and leadership functions, has a significant influence on improving learning effectiveness. Competent and motivated teachers, as a result of good HRM, are a direct determinant of the quality of classroom learning.

Abstract

This study aims to analyze the contribution of the student management system to non-academic achievement at SD Negeri 1 Banjarnegeri, Tanggamus District, particularly in the Festival Lomba Seni dan Sastra Siswa Nasional (FLS3N). The school’s achievements in story writing, storytelling, and expressive drawing indicate the presence of an effective and well-structured student management system. This research employed a descriptive qualitative approach with a case study design. Informants included the principal, the vice principal for student affairs, FLS3N coaches, award-winning students, and parents selected through purposive sampling. Data were collected through in-depth interviews, observations, and document analysis, and examined using the Miles, Huberman, and Saldana model consisting of data reduction, data display, and conclusion drawing. The findings show that structured planning, clear organizational roles, intensive coaching, adequate supporting facilities, and continuous monitoring and evaluation play a crucial role in improving non-academic coaching quality. The student management system significantly contributes to students’ achievements, as evidenced by their awards at the sub-district and district levels in three FLS3N competition categories. The study concludes that a comprehensive and consistent student management system is effective in optimizing students’ potential and enhancing non-academic achievements in primary schools. Abstract

This research aimed to determine the significant effect of elementary students’ beginning reading skill before and after the use of the AGEMARA application. The research employed a quantitative method with a “One Group Pretest–Posttest Design”. The research subjects were the grade II students of State Elementary School 2 Jobokuto (SD Negeri 2 Jobokuto). The data were collected through a beginner reading test to examine students’ beginning reading skills before and after the use of the media. The data were analyzed using a paired sample t-test to identify whether there was a significant difference before and after the use of the AGEMARA application. In addition, the N-Gain score test was conducted to analyze the improvement obtained by the students after using AGEMARA. The findings indicated a difference in the level of students’ beginning reading skills that were showed by the paired sample t-test result which showed a Sig value of 0.000 ≥ 0.10. Furthermore, an improvement in students’ beginning reading skills after the treatment using the AGEMARA application demonstrated by the N-Gain score of 0.18, if this value is viewed using the N-Gain Score classification category, the value obtained was 0.20 ≥ 0.2 and can be stated in the “Medium” category.

Abstract

The low level of students’ digital literacy in Akidah Akhlak learning remains a challenge, particularly due to the dominance of traditional lecture-based instruction. This study aimed to enhance students’ digital literacy through the implementation of the Wordwall game as a learning medium in Grade VIII Akidah Akhlak at SMP Namira, Probolinggo City. The study employed a quantitative approach with a quasi-experimental design. The research subjects consisted of 30 students, divided into 15 students in the experimental class and 15 students in the control class, selected based on their level of understanding of the concepts of honesty and trustworthiness. The research was conducted from October 18 to 22, 2025. Data were collected through pretests and posttests, interviews, and documentation. The results showed that the average score of the experimental class increased from 54.6 to 67.3, while the control class experienced only a relatively low improvement. These findings indicate that the use of the Wordwall game is effective in improving students’ digital literacy and fostering more active and meaningful learning.

Abstract

Genetic regulation of plant development involves a complex network of transcription factors, microRNAs, epigenetic modifications, and hormonal signals that together determine growth patterns, differentiation, and environmental responses. This review synthesizes findings from five recent (2019–2025) journal articles highlighting roles of key transcription factors, miRNAs, epigenetic mechanisms, and hormonal interplay in controlling root, leaf, and vegetative-to-reproductive transitions. We performed a systematic literature search on databases (PubMed, Web of Science, Google Scholar) using targeted keywords and selected five representative reviews and studies. Results indicate multilayered integration: (1) transcription factors act as central regulatory nodes; (2) miRNAs fine-tune developmental transitions by regulating target transcripts; (3) epigenetic marks set dynamic chromatin states; and (4) hormone crosstalk aligns environmental cues with genetic programs. CRISPR-based genome editing provides tools for functional dissection and crop improvement. In conclusion, an integrative understanding of genetic regulation offers pathways for targeted interventions to develop more adaptive, productive plant varieties.

Abstract

This study examines the perceptions of fifth-grade students in Maulafa Subdistrict, Sikumana Village, Kupang City regarding homework within the framework of the Merdeka Curriculum, which emphasizes autonomy, meaningful learning, and student-centered instruction. Employing a qualitative descriptive design, data were collected through semi-structured interviews involving five students and two classroom teacher. The findings indicate that students generally perceive homework as instrumental in strengthening conceptual understanding and maintaining learning continuity outside school hours. However, certain subjects particularly mathematics are identified as sources of difficulty, whereas language-related assignments are considered more manageable and engaging. Students also demonstrate a preference for homework that involves written tasks, book-based responses, and collaborative work, reflecting alignment with the curriculum’s emphasis on learning independence and social learning. The teacher’s perspective further supports the relevance of homework, provided that assignments remain proportional, clear, and directly connected to classroom instruction. The study concludes that homework retains pedagogical significance in the Merdeka Curriculum era, although its design requires careful calibration to ensure it remains supportive, non-burdensome, and conducive to fostering student motivation and responsibility.

Abstract

The assessment aims to demonstrate the level of competency mastery of students and the effectiveness of the learning methods applied by educators. Based on interviews conducted with Indonesian language teachers of eighth grade students at SMP Negeri 2 Sumbang, it was found that the level of student achievement of the minimum passing grade (KKM) in the Final Year Assessment was still relatively low. The quality of the questions greatly determines the effectiveness of assessing student competency. This study aims to analyze the quality of the final assessment questions for the Indonesian language subject for eighth grade students at SMP Negeri 2 Sumbang for the 2024/2025 academic year. This study used a quantitative approach with a descriptive method. The research object consisted of 45 PAT questions with a sample of 144 students. Data were obtained through documentation techniques and analyzed using a classical test theory approach assisted by the Anates application. The analysis focused on the aspects of validity, reliability, difficulty level, discriminating power, and effectiveness of distractors. The results showed that the quality of PAT items still varied and did not fully meet the criteria for a quality assessment instrument. Some items were not valid, the test reliability coefficient was low, the difficulty level distribution was not balanced, the discriminating power of some items was still weak, and most distractors did not function optimally.
